What is 81/42 Divided By 9/7

Answer: 8142÷97\frac{81}{42}\div\frac{9}{7} = 32\frac{3}{2}

Solving 8142÷97\frac{81}{42}\div\frac{9}{7}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

8142÷97=8142×79\frac{81}{42} \div \frac{9}{7} = \frac{81}{42} \times \frac{7}{9}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 81×7=56781 \times 7 = 567
  • Multiply the Denominators: 42×9=37842 \times 9 = 378
  • Form the New Fraction: 8142×97=567378\frac{81}{42} \times \frac{9}{7} = \frac{567}{378}

Let's Simplify 567378\frac{567}{378}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 567567 and 378378. The GCD of 567567 and 378378 is 189189.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:567÷189378÷189=32\frac{567 \div 189}{378 \div 189} = \frac{3}{2}

Answer 8142÷97=32\frac{81}{42}\div\frac{9}{7} = \frac{3}{2}
